How To Fix /J7L/PRICING521 - Arithmetical error &1 in fee formula


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/J7L/PRICING -

  • Message number: 521

  • Message text: Arithmetical error &1 in fee formula

    The SAP error message /J7L/PRICING521 Arithmetical error &1 in fee formula typically indicates that there is an issue with the calculation logic defined in a fee formula within the SAP system. This error can arise due to various reasons, such as division by zero, invalid data types, or incorrect formula syntax.

    Causes:

    1. Division by Zero: If the formula involves division and the denominator evaluates to zero, this will trigger an arithmetical error.
    2. Invalid Data Types: If the formula is trying to perform operations on incompatible data types (e.g., trying to perform arithmetic on a string).
    3. Incorrect Formula Logic: The formula may have logical errors or may not be properly defined.
    4. Missing or Incorrect Input Values: If the input values required for the calculation are missing or incorrect, it can lead to errors.
    5. Configuration Issues: There may be issues in the configuration of the pricing procedure or fee formula.

    Solutions:

    1. Check the Formula: Review the fee formula for any logical errors or syntax issues. Ensure that all operations are valid and that the formula is correctly defined.
    2. Validate Input Values: Ensure that all input values used in the formula are present and valid. Check for any null or zero values that could lead to division by zero.
    3. Debugging: Use debugging tools in SAP to trace the execution of the formula and identify where the error occurs.
    4. Data Type Verification: Ensure that all variables used in the formula are of the correct data type and can be used in arithmetic operations.
    5.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for guidance on the specific fee formula and its expected behavior.
    6. Test with Sample Data: Create test cases with known input values to see if the formula behaves as expected.
